  • Patent number: 5384046
    Abstract: A screen element or screen basket for sorting and classifying a fluid flow, in particular for treatment of fiber suspensions or for mechanical purification of molasses, includes a screen insert having a support screen for taking up forces or loads during operation and a plurality of screen inserts which are provided with classifying openings. The screen inserts are detachably secured to the support screen allowing individual replacement during wear or damage.

  • Patent number: 5258120
    Abstract: A disk filter for filtering solids from free-flowing material includes a hollow shaft and a plurality of filter segments arranged about the hollow shaft, with each filter segment including a top part and a bottom part connected to the top part such as to define a passageway for the material to be filtered. At the radial inner end face, each filter segment is detachably secured to the hollow shaft via an interposed connector assembly which includes two pipes telescopically nested within each other and detachable secured with each other via a bayonet lock or other detachable securement so as to allow each filter segment to be removed and attached from the outer end face of the filter segment. One of the pipe is mounted to the filter segment via a truncated cone shaped intermediate member and the other pipe is attached to the hollow shaft.

  • Patent number: 5255790
    Abstract: A screening apparatus, in particular a bar screen for sorting and classifying fluid flows, especially fiber suspensions includes parallel bar-shaped screen elements mounted on cross bars and defining slotted screening perforations therebetween. At its top surface facing the fluid flow, each screen element is provided with a projection in form of a rib or bead or the like of different cross section to provide an irregular screening surface. The screening slot between neighboring screen elements is defined by at least one wall section which extends parallel to the midplane of the screening slot in order to reduce an expansion of the slot due to wear.

  • Patent number: 5073254
    Abstract: A cylindrical screening basket for sorting and classifying fiber suspensions includes a wall which has an inner wall surface facing the fiber suspension and is provided with screen openings which lead into grooves arranged at the inner wall surface. The grooves extend essentially parallel to each other and transversely to the flow direction of the fiber suspension and are arched to define a downstream flank and an upstream flank, with the downstream flank having a sharper curvature than the upstream flank.
